A apresentação está carregando. Por favor, espere

A apresentação está carregando. Por favor, espere

David Santos dwfs@cin.ufpe.br Evolução da Web Da 1.0 a 3.0 David Santos dwfs@cin.ufpe.br.

Apresentações semelhantes


Apresentação em tema: "David Santos dwfs@cin.ufpe.br Evolução da Web Da 1.0 a 3.0 David Santos dwfs@cin.ufpe.br."— Transcrição da apresentação:

1 David Santos dwfs@cin.ufpe.br
Evolução da Web Da 1.0 a 3.0 David Santos

2 Agenda Motivação Surgimento da Web Web 1.0 e suas tecnologias
O futuro da Web, a Web 4.0

3 Motivação A web é um espaço de informação
Oferecer uma visão geral da evolução da web Conhecer as tecnologias que estão atreladas em cada evolução

4 Como tudo começou? . Redudância Redudância Redudância Redudância

5 Banco de Dados Bancos de dados distribuídos e as Federações de banco de dados

6 Eis que surge a ... Criada por Tim Berners Lee!

7 INTERNET X WEB Internet Web
É uma rede que conecta milhões de computadores pelo mundo; Web É uma das várias ferramentas de acesso a essa rede; (ambiente)

8 Surgimento da Internet
Decada de 60 (Guerra Fria) J.C.R. Licklider – “Rede Galáctica” ARPANET

9 Decada de 70 Realizada a primeira conexão entre dois continentes
Aumento no Numero de Servidores Protocolo TCP/IP

10 Tim Berners-Lee, da Organização Europeia para Investigação Nuclear (CERN) , desenvolveu a World Wide Web.

11 WORLD WIDE WEB Permite o leitor pular rapidamente de um documento para outro. A forma padrão das informações do WWW é o hipertexto. CERN lançou o código-fonte do WorldWideWeb. Criação da W3C (World Wide Web Consortium)

12 WEB 1.0 Web 1.0 foi a primeira implementação de web Unidirecional

13 Tecnologias da WEB 1.0 Protocolo de Transferência de Hipertexto (HTTP): Linguagem de Marcação de Hipertexto (HTML): URI (Uniform Resource Identifier)

14 WEB 2.0 O termo Web 2.0 foi utilizado pela primeira vez pela empresa norte americana O’ Reilly Media em 2004 Compartilhamento de informação e a colaboração

15 Serviços da WEB 2.0

16 Redes Sociais Explosão em 2006 Milhões de usuários; Interações:
Participar de diferentes grupos Criar redes próprias Compartilhar fotos, vídeos e mensagens Postar anúncios e classificados, etc.

17 Blogs Publicação diversos conteúdos de forma cronólogica.
A maioria dos blogs são textuais, porém: Fotologs(Fotos) VideoBlogs(Videos) Podcasts

18 Wikis Páginas comunitárias Maneira fácil de trocar idéias

19 RSS Abreviação de "really simple syndication" [distribuição realmente simples]; Tecnologia "pull" e "push"; "Assinando um feed".

20 Tecnologias da Web 2.0 Três abordagens básicas de desenvolvimento para criar aplicações da web 2.0 AJAX; Adobe Flex; Google Toolkit.

21 AJAX Abreviação para “Asynchronous JavaScript and XML”;
Velocidade nas interações dos usuários; Aplicação desktop.

22 Adobe Flex RIA – Rich Internet Aplications (Aplicações Ricas para Internet); Aplicação desktop;

23 Google Web Toolkit Toolkit de código-fonte aberto; Ajax + Java;

24 WEB 1.0 X WEB 2.0 Web 1.0 Web 2.0 Leitura Leitura/Escrita Empresas
Comunidade Cliente/Servidor Peer to Peer Dados proprietários Dados compartilhados Formulários Web Aplicações Web

25 WEB 3.0 Usar de maneira mais inteligente todo o conhecimento já disponível. Web semântica Principais Objetivos da WEB 3.0: Tornar a Web legivel por maquina; Permitir buscas mais complexas; Trasnformar a Web de Documentos em Web de Dados

26 ARQUITETURA DA WEB SEMÂNTICA

27 UNICODE/URI UNICODE URI- Uniform Resource Identifier
Representar qualquer caráter exclusivamente. URI- Uniform Resource Identifier Identificadores únicos para recursos da web.

28 XML + NS + XMLSCHEMA XML (Extensible Markup Language)
Marcar documentos que contêm informações estruturadas. NS (XMLnamespace) Uma coleção de nomes. XMLSCHEMA As regras para validar documentos XML

29 RDF + RDF SCHEMA RDF - Resource Description Framework RDF SCHEMA
Descrever recursos da web SPARQL RDF SCHEMA Definir esquema para documentos RDF.

30 Ontologias Camada mais importante Serve de Vocabulário
Representar uma area de conhecimento. Ferramentas Protegé; pOWL; OntoEdit.

31 Logica, Prova e Confiança
Camada Lógica Consultar Filtrar Concluir Liguagens: RuleML, DAML-L e F-Logic Prova e Confiança são camadas pouco desenvolvidas.

32 Como relacionar esse dados?
Conjunto de regras que tornaram-se conhecidos como Linked Data

33 Principios Linked Data
Usar URI’s como nomes para recursos; Usar URI’s HTTP para procurar esses nomes; Fornecer informações úteis, usando os padrões (RDF, SPARQL) por procurar um URI; Incluir links para outros URIs para descobrir mais coisas.

34 WEB 4.0, o futuro da web. Inteligência artificial. Problemas:
Invasão de privacidade Controle Depedência Sobrecarga

35 “A tecnologia não é boa nem ruim, tudo depende do uso que as pessoas fazem dela” Manuel Castells

36 Principais Referências
AGHAEI, S.; NEMATBAKHSH, M; FARSANI, H. "Evolution of the Word Wide Web: From Web 1.0 to Web 4.0", 2012; NUPUR CHOUDHURY. " World Wide Web and Its Journey from Web 1.0 to Web 4.0 ", 2014; KAREM PATEL. " Incremental Journey for World Wide Web: Introduced with Web 1.0 to Recent Web 5.0 – A Survey Paper " , 2013; M. RAJENDRA PRASAD, DR. B. MANJULA, V.BAPUJI. " A Novel Overview and Evolution of World Wide Web: Comparison from Web 1.0 to Web 3.0 ",2013.

37 David Santos dwfs@cin.ufpe.br
Evolução da Web Da 1.0 a 3.0 David Santos


Carregar ppt "David Santos dwfs@cin.ufpe.br Evolução da Web Da 1.0 a 3.0 David Santos dwfs@cin.ufpe.br."

Apresentações semelhantes


Anúncios Google